What does a senior treasury analyst do?

A Senior Treasury Analyst is responsible for managing an organization’s cash flow, liquidity, investments, and financial risk. They analyze financial data, forecast cash needs, and develop strategies to optimize the company's financial position. Additionally, they may oversee banking relationships, assist with debt management, and ensure compliance with internal policies and regulatory requirements. Their expertise helps organizations maintain financial stability and make informed financial decisions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ior treasury anal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Treasury Analyst, you need strong financial analysis skills, a solid understanding of cash management, and typically a degree in finance, accounting, or a related field. Familiarity with treasury management systems (TMS), Excel, and often certifications like CTP (Certified Treasury Professional) are commonly required. Exceptional att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help set top performers apart. These skills ensure accurate cash forecasting, risk management, and efficient financial operations that are critical to an organization's liquidity and financial health.

How does a senior treasury analyst typ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

A Senior Treasury Analyst frequently works with departments such as accounting, finance, and operations to manage cash flow, optimize liquidity, and support corporate financial strategies. This collaboration often involves participating in cross-functional meetings, providing financial forecasts, and coordinating on major transactions or investments. Successful analysts build strong relationships across teams to ensure seamless treasury operations and to support broader business objectives.

The Senior Treasury Analyst typically handles more strategic financial planning and risk management, requiring more experience and certifications. The Treasury Analyst focuses on daily cash management and operational tasks. Both roles are essential in corporate treasury functions, but the senior position involves higher-level decision-making and oversight.

The Treasury Analyst will play a key role in managing cash flow, investments, and financial reporting. This position involves a variety of analytical, reporting, and administrative duties to ensure effective cash management and financial operations. The Treasury Analyst will support senior leadership with critical financial data, manage treasury-related databases, and contribute to the development and maintenance of financial policies and procedures.
Responsibilities:
• Prepare and manage daily cash positions, short-term forecasts, and cash flow needs.
• Reconcile cash accounts and transactions, including wire transfers and ACH payments, with general ledger postings.
• Track and analyze cash and investment activity, ensuring accurate and timely reporting of financial information.
• Develop and interpret critical analytics related to cash flow, investments, and other treasury-related data.
• Prepare comprehensive reports on cash and investment activities, including the Cash Note Report, Investment Report, and cash flow projections.
• Analyze financial records and data to identify trends, inefficiencies, and opportunities for improvement.
• Manage and reconcile treasury databases and ensure alignment with operational teams.
• Post entries to ERP/accounting systems in compliance with established guidelines.
• Assist with the preparation of final reports, including data editing and the creation of charts and presentations.
• Develop and update procedures and policies to reflect current processes and enhance operational efficiency.
• Support other cash management functions and departmental projects as needed.
